The smoothest chains allow the handler to make the correction and release quickly- and to have the dog learn to cue to the correction sound as the collar is run through the links, accompanied by the word "no!". Make sure the collar is able to slip and release on the proper side- they don't work if the collar is on backwards and gets caught on itself. Safer than a headcollar.
